    Welcome to this beautifully appointed one-bedroom, one-bathroom co-op at the iconic 24 Fifth Avenue, a pre-war iconic former hotel in the heart of Greenwich Village. This charming home has been artistically decorated by the owner, a West Village artist, combining unique design elements with modern conveniences. Step into a light-filled living space featuring high beamed ceilings that add warm character to each room. The custom radiator cabinetry blends seamlessly into the living space, offering a refined, elegant appearance. The separate kitchen blends vintage-inspired charm with modern functionality, featuring stainless-steel appliances and ample custom cabinetry. Standouts include its elegant archway entrance, bold blue accents, and fanciful floor tiles—a curated mosaic that is an art piece itself. The dining area, highlighted by a striking wood-accented wall, creates a warm and inviting atmosphere for hosting dinner parties or enjoying a quiet meal. The bedroom offers generous proportions, comfortably accommodating a king-size bed, a home office setup, and a full set of furniture, with the added convenience of a walk-in closet. The beautifully renovated subway-tile bathroom creates a fresh and timeless feel. The south-facing windows invite abundant natural light throughout the day, adding to the home's bright and welcoming ambiance. Originally designed by the renowned Emery Roth & Sons as the luxurious Fifth Avenue Hotel in 1926, 24 Fifth Avenue retains its grandeur with a beautifully restored marble lobby, 24-hour doorman, a fitness center, modern laundry facilities, and bike storage. Residents enjoy a prime location just steps from Washington Square Park, Michelin-starred dining, boutique shopping, and multiple subway lines, making every corner of Manhattan easily accessible. Maintenance shown factor in an owner-occupied abatement. Pre-abatement maintenance is $2004.73.
